The 48 Laws of Power by Robert Greene
The 48 Laws of Power is Robert Greene’s classic exploration of influence, ambition, and human behavior. Drawing lessons from history’s greatest leaders, thinkers, and strategists, this book reveals the principles that govern power — how to gain it, protect it, and wield it effectively.
Timeless Strategies for Influence
From “Never Outshine the Master” to “Conceal Your Intentions,” each law offers practical wisdom to help readers understand the subtle dynamics of human relationships. Greene’s concise rules and vivid examples make this book both engaging and thought-provoking.
A Blend of History and Psychology
Through stories and case studies from across centuries, Greene illustrates how power has shaped nations, movements, and individuals. His narrative style transforms complex strategies into lessons that can be applied in modern life.
Practical Applications
Whether you want to strengthen your leadership, protect yourself from manipulation, or better understand the world of influence, The 48 Laws of Power offers tools to guide personal and professional success.
